Longman Dictionary English

Word family noun debate debater verb debate
From Longman Dictionary of Contemporary Englishdebaterde‧bat‧er /dɪˈbeɪtə $ -ər/ noun [countable] someone who speaks in a formal debate
Examples from the Corpus
debater• He was a debater, if not an intellectual.• Dole is a wise and experienced debater.• But is he a better-humored debater?• Though small and frail, he was a powerful and lucid debater.• He was a redoubtable debater with a caustic tongue in polemics and a nice touch in irony in writing.
